    Any one help me sort this text out pls?
    Its the smaller print I am stuck with.
    I can make out the 120k and 65k.

  5. #25

    Re: Nieuport 11 WIP

    Looking really REALLY good Jester! Try adding a little mud splatter and dirt to the lower rudder and lower rear fuselage.
    BEAUTIFUL!!!!

    About the text-
    Check page 45 of Nieuport Fighters Vol.1.
    POIDS UTILE (USEFUL WEIGHT)
    120K
    COMBUSTABLE (ARMAMENT?)
    65K
    I don't know that there is a period after the K, or is it a k? The lower arm and serif might just be heavy.
